Sat 791520120353367

decimal
158304.120353367
degree
0°158304′1056″120353367‴
percentile
37.691434344001884%
name
ifyvefdndla
cycle
0
epoch
0
period
78
block
158304
offset
120353367
timestamp
rarity
common